Get free rules, notes, crosswalks, synonyms, history for ICD-10 code S46.811A. Jan 18, 2016 · Injuries to the Acromioclavicular (AC) Joints are very common among shoulder injuries. ICD-9 is of no help in coding these injuries , and ICD-10 has a very complicated and non-customary approach. Anatomically, it is the small joint between the lateral/distal end of the Clavicle/Collar Bone and the Acromial process of the Scapula/Shoulder Blade. Use secondary code (s) from Chapter 20, External causes of morbidity, to indicate cause of injury.In ICD-10-CM, an acute traumatic tear or rupture of a muscle or tendon is classified as a strain (think sTrain = tendon/muscle/fascia). A strain may be an overstretched muscle or a partial or complete tear.
